Battling Nomads hold Wingmen

HONOURS were even at Broughton last night, a result that benefits Nomads’ relegation survival hopes and keeps the Wingmakers’ record-breaking season on track.

Airbus have never beaten the north Wales coast side in four attempts on home soil but James McIntosh had a good opportunity late on to break their duck only to head wide when well placed.

The first half saw lots of endeavour but little creativity, but the home side were the dominant force after the break and the best chances fell in their favour.

However, they failed to convert any and it could have been costly as visitors’ midfielder Craig Jones nearly punished them, but his goal-bound effort was tipped over the bar by Chris Doran.
